📖 Overview

Pseudecheneis Crassicauda (Pseudecheneis crassicauda) is a ray-finned fish of the family Sisoridae. It inhabits freshwater waters in benthic environments. This species can reach a maximum total length of 13.7 cm. With a trophic level of 3.2, it is a low-level carnivore, feeding on invertebrates and small organisms. It is assessed as Data Deficient on the IUCN Red List.

🐟 Physical Description

Dorsal soft rays (total): 7; Anal soft rays: 10 - 13; Vertebrae: 38 - 39. Distinguished from its congeners by the unique combination of the following characters: 38-39 vertebrae, caudal peduncle depth 6.0-6.9% SL, eye diameter 7.5-8.3% HL, length of adipose-fin base 20.3-24.3% SL, pelvic fins reaching the base of the first anal-fin ray, and the presence of pale spots on the body . : elongated.
